Aluminium Strip for Lamp Base

Our lampcap materials combines strength and high formability with high resistance to softening in vitriting. Manufactured at modern and well-equipped mills, it can be rolled to very fine tolerances, allowing more caps per tonne of coil and enabling uninterrupted operations of high-speed forming presses.

Specification (mm)

Alloy Temper Type Thickness Width U.T.S(Mpa)  Elongation(%) 
3004 O Strip Coil 0.25-0.40mm 85-400  155-200  ≥13 

Chemical Composition

Alloy Si Fe Cu Mn Mg Cr Ni Zn Ga Ti Al
3004 ≤0.3 ≤0.7 ≤0.25 1.0-1.5 0.8-1.3 ≤0.05 ≤0.05 ≤0.25 - ≤0.05 other
Application: Bulb Caps, Tube Caps, Caps of fluorescent tube lights Electrical Sector, etc

Advantage of 3004 Aluminum Strip:
AA 3004 Aluminum Strip is categorized as Wrought Aluminum Alloy Strip. It is composed of (in weight percentage) 97.8% Aluminum (Al), 1.2% Manganese (Mn), and 1.0% Magnesium (Mg). It can be seen in forms of sheet, plate, extruded tubes, and drawn tube. Aluminum is a silverish white metal that has a strong resistance to corrosion and like gold, is rather malleable. It is a relatively light metal compared to metals such as steel, nickel, brass, and copper with a specific gravity of 2.7. 3004 Aluminum Strip is easily machinable and can have a wide variety of surface finishes. It also has good electrical and thermal conductivities and is highly reflective to heat and light.
The typical elastic modulus of aluminum alloys Strip at room temperature (25°C) ranges from 70 to 79 GPa. The typical density of aluminum alloys ranges from 2.6 to 2.8 g/cm3. The typical tensile strength varies between 230 and 570 MPa. The wide range of ultimate tensile strength is largely due to different heat treatment conditions
Forming AL 3004 is easily formed by either cold or hot working with conventional tooling.
